About The Artwork

The weekly tribal markets ("haats") were a visual cacophony of people, produce and panoramas. There were also some great walls.

WHO IS DENISE SOLAY? Her first passion was ballet. She lived it. She loved it. It was her dream. It became her reality, first, with The Royal Ballet in London, later, with great ballet companies in New York and then on the Broadway stage. Her second passion was, and still is, travel. Nothing can compete with the romance, mystery and excitement of places such as Algeria, Morocco, Burma, Ethiopia, Mauritania, Syria, Yemen, Java, Thailand, Sri Lanka, India and Nepal - just a few of the exotic visa stamps that fill her well worn passports. During these trips collecting rare pieces to be used in her jewelry design business of contemporary jewelry with “Hints of History”, she developed a discerning eye by taking pictures of these exotic people and places. Her powerful photographs convey a deep understanding of the lifestyles and mores of these cultures and seem to transport her subjects across time and oceans into our consciousness. As fewer and fewer people were still wearing their traditional dress and were beginning to all dress the same... t-shirts, jeans, etc… she realized that the walls that she walked past every day, were even more interesting and evocative of the local history. Their textures, colors and time evolved layers created amazing abstract images. To date, she has captured thousands of fabulous abstract wall images from around the world for her canvas wall art collection, WALLS ON WALLS.
